Metallica Concert Setlist Info

Metallica have prided themselves on creating a unique setlist for each show since touring their 2003 album St. Anger, but the group decided to raise the bar further for the M72 World Tour, which often features two shows per city with no-repeat songs. The stadium-sized venues will also face a new configuration with the band performing on a ring-shaped stage, placing their dedicated Snake Pit fan section directly in the center.

Although each Metallica setlist is unique by design, the band still delivers many of their most familiar, most-played songs, including “Master of Puppets,” “Enter Sandman,” “Seek & Destroy” and “For Whom the Bell Tolls.” The band has also seamlessly installed newer material from their 2023 album 72 Seasons such as the Grammy-winning title track and singles like “Lux Æterna,” “If Darkness Had a Son” and “Screaming Suicide.”

Below, you can find a breakdown of Metallica’s live setlist from JMA Wireless Dome on April 19, 2025; the performance opened the North American leg of the ongoing 2025 M72 World Tour.

Metallica Tour Stats

Current tour: M72 World Tour (2023-2025)

Set time: On the M72 World Tour, Metallica usually goes on stage between 8:50 and 9:20 p.m., though set times vary.

Length of average Metallica show: 2 hours, 4 minutes (on M72 World Tour)
